Bolton balances quiet, lake-dotted scenery with quick connections to Hartford, Manchester, and Vernon, right in Tolland County. I‑384, Route 6, and the historic Boston Turnpike make commutes straightforward, while the Town of Bolton keeps residents plugged into essential services and community events.
Nature is part of daily life here: explore dramatic cliffs and shaded hollows at Bolton Notch State Park, or ride and jog the scenic Hop River State Park Trail. The Bolton Lakes invite paddling, fishing, and summer sunsets, supported by stewardship partners like the Bolton Land Trust. History fans gravitate to Bolton Heritage Farm, where broad fields recall the French encampments along the Washington–Rochambeau route and today host seasonal walks and community gatherings.
Schools are a point of pride. Bolton Public Schools offer small class sizes, strong arts and STEM programming, and a high school recognized for AP coursework and competitive athletics. The Bentley Memorial Library anchors year‑round programming—from story times to maker nights—while town recreation fills calendars with youth sports, lakefront activities, and concerts on the green.
